利用C制作仿QQ好友列表,实现思路
浏览量:2273
时间:2024-04-19 16:12:28
作者:采采
在C WinForm中,许多开发者希望界面更加美观。由于QQ界面设计优秀,许多人尝试模仿。本文将分享在编写仿QQ程序时,制作QQ好友列表的一些关键思路。虽然不提供源码,但会介绍如何整体制作,具体代码将在后续文章中分享。
1. 创建“列表对象”
首先,将好友列表视为一个面板(Panel),在该面板中放置各种其他控件。
2. 设计“分组对象”
将每个好友分组看作一个对象,由一个标签(Label)和一个面板组成。通过修改标签的背景图案和文字,以及标签的单击事件,来控制对应面板的显示与隐藏,以及调整标签中的图标,从而达到想要的效果。
3. 定义“好友对象”
每个好友包含头像、昵称、个性签名等信息,可以看作一个独立的对象,由一个图片框(PictureBox)和两个标签构成。通过调整标签和图片框的内边距属性以及事件处理,实现所需的布局效果。
4. 灵活设置对象位置
为每个对象添加标识,动态计算位置,并设置控件的位置属性。确保各对象在“列表对象”中正确显示。在面板属性中,可以设定面板是否自动扩展以容纳所有对象。
5. 多思考,多发现
学习软件开发需要不断思考和探索。通过本文提供的思路和方法,希望能激发初学者的灵感,并帮助他们更深入地理解C编程和界面设计。只有自己思考,才能真正掌握知识。希望这些经验对初学者有所启发和帮助。
通过以上步骤,你可以利用C WinForm制作出类似QQ好友列表的界面,展示好友分组和个人信息。这种仿真设计不仅锻炼了界面设计能力,也提升了对C编程语言的熟练程度。希望本文的分享对你在编写仿QQ程序时有所帮助,激发你的创作灵感。
版权声明:本文内容由互联网用户自发贡献,本站不承担相关法律责任.如有侵权/违法内容,本站将立刻删除。